NH10 closed for maintenance on May 17 and 19

DARJEELING, : Traffic movement on NH 10, the main route connecting Sikkim and Kalimpong to the plains, was closed for traffic on Thrusday and will remain closed on May 17 and 19 as well.

The closure comes after a National Highways & Infrastructure Development Corporation Ltd. (NHIDCL) order. The NHIDCL, which looks after NH 10, said the closure is for ongoing maintenance and rehabilitation work in different parts of the 52-km highway stretch. Traffic movement is being restricted in the Highway from 9 am to 6 pm.

The order states that the NH 10 was being closed due to anticipated congestion and safety considerations of vehicles plying on the particular section of the NH on account of ongoing emergent works.

It maintains that on May 15, 17 and 19, the highway will be closed for all classes of vehicles.

It further adds that on May 16 and 18, the NH section would remain open for all traffic except commercial vehicles with laden weight exceeding 10MT laden weight.

The NHIDCL attended that the movement of all heavy vehicles (goods) shall be invariably prohibited only from 9 am to 6 pm on the NH-10 section and that the internal movement of NHIDCL, IRCON and NHPC vehicles working on Sevoke-Rangpo section shall be allowed only in-between the work locations.

Small vehicles for these three days in which the highway will remain closed has been diverted via Peshok while heavy vehicles are plying from Lava.
